Redwood Lake
Redwood Lake is a lake in Sonoma County, California. Redwood Lake is situated nearby to the hamlet Venado, as well as near Rio Nido.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Rio Nido, California is a small, unincorporated resort community on the Russian River, in Sonoma County, California, United States. It is situated 1.3 mi east of Guerneville. Rio Nido is situated 3½ miles southeast of Redwood Lake.
